It's quite easy really. Just find an image you want to use. It's easier and more realistic if you use an image or picture that was taken from a similar angle.

Cut out the side and back of the trailer. Then just scale it and skew it until you have it how you want it. You'll also need to do this with two layers, one for the side and one for the back.

If you wanted, you could also add a motion blur to the background. Here is an example. I really didn't feel like looking for a good pic, so I just used a wallpaper I had. :D
